Where do the Mexican drug lords really get their guns?

Mexico's Gun Supply and the 90 Percent Myth
It has now become quite common to hear U.S. officials confidently assert that 90 percent of the weapons used by the Mexican drug cartels come from the United States. However, a close examination of the dynamics of the cartel wars in Mexico — and of how the oft-echoed 90 percent number was reached — clearly demonstrates that the number is more political rhetoric than empirical fact.

Of course, the source of this figure is that that ATF was given thousands of guns to trace, and of those successfully traced, approximately 90% were traced to the US. But why submit guns to the ATF for tracing if there aren't indications that they come from the US? So, the 80% of seized guns that are not traced are hard to account for. You have to assume that they are not submitted because there isn't an indication that they could be traced. After all, you don't submit thousands of guns for tracing to conduct a statistical study (you certainly wouldn't need that large of a sample size), they're submitted to aid in investigations. If submitting gun serial numbers to the ATF would be a waste of time, they won't be sent.
